Scan Line Polygon Fill Algorithm - Raster Graphics
In such algorithm, the information for a solid body is stored in the frame buffer and utilizing that information each pixel that is, of both interior region and boundary are considered and, are so plotted. This time we are going to perform scan conversion of solid regions; here the areas are bounded through polygonal lines. Pixels are considered for the interior of the polygonal area and are then filled plotted along with the predefined colour. Now let us discuss the algorithm briefly and then we will further discuss details on the similar.
This algorithm checks and modifies the attributes (that is parameters and characteristics) of the pixels only with the current raster scan line. Immediately it crosses over from the outside to the inside of a boundary of the particular polygon it begins resetting the colour or as gray attribute. In filling effect the region along that scans line. Such changes back to the initial attribute while it crosses the boundary again. In following figure, shows variations of this basic idea.
